Joseph
by Katrina L Mitchell © 2008

Envious eyes and jealous hearts
Cast you in despair
They turned their backs and walked away
For dead they left you there

Ah-Ha, Ah-Ha; Now tell us of your dream
Unknowing to your brothers
You were rescued to safety
As strangers heard your screams

Drawn up from hell
You were sold for a slave
First to Potiphar, then to prison
But with integrity you behaved

Held in chains of iron
Until the time your word came
Those you loved tried to bury your dream
Yet your destiny remained the same

In one day, with one word
From the prison, to the throne
The Lord was there the entire time
Taking you where you belong
